  • Title

    An adaptive chirp modem for medium data rates

  • Abstract
    The authors describe an experimental HF modem which uses serially transmitted chirp signals swept across a voice channel bandwidth. The modem is able to adaptively excise interference from other HF users, and has inherent tolerance to frequency selective fading and additive white Gaussian noise. A number of experimental signal formats have been incorporated so as to achieve data transmission at rates of 75, 150, 300 and 600 bits per second, and error correction via interleaved Golay code is included
